Output ed805354ab7283ed99077824198f27d4ea11e0daad7e266d0b58284ce18f1a3f:1

value
5463899206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 905ddccea8ebc98f297ce993d6ebc0eda731ffdd OP_EQUAL
address
3ErMfrG7wKrjaZw8LtTGaE8FWLFsWXVaAx
transaction
ed805354ab7283ed99077824198f27d4ea11e0daad7e266d0b58284ce18f1a3f
confirmations
508971
spent
true